I can do all things through Christ who strengthens me.” (Philippians 4:13)
It is amazing how God works. When you least expect it, it happens. I haven’t written anything for years on the computer because I didn’t think I could but guess what? Here I am. Writing to you. . .whoever you are. You see, I’ve been here before. Years ago I had written devotionals like this for Rest Ministries and thoroughly enjoyed doing it. I have multiple sclerosis and I am a quadriplegic, in a wheelchair. I am not able to do hardly anything for myself–things like eating, bathing, going to the bathroom, brushing my teeth.
BUT GOD — These are 2 of my favorite words in the Bible – “But God.”
God has also given me a beautiful husband, who sees me not for what I can do, but for who I am.
God has given me a beautiful caregiver who has spent the whole morning helping me use this computer software.
God has given me software that allows me to speak my devotional to you.
God is so good to me in so many ways. He strengthens me each day with His amazing Grace and His amazing love.
“When I am weak, He is strong.” How well I have learned that! What ever you are facing today, cry out to Him and He Will help you to endure it. Keep seeking the things above and keep your eyes fixed on Jesus, The Author and Perfecter of our faith.
Love, Frieda
